Falasan Flag mini.png Turmoil in Abington

August 31th 2007


Just after Abington reclaimed the city of Riverholm and effectively ended the Aquitaine Succession the City of Wayburg and its duchy regions have left Abington.
But just a day after its creation no leader has been found and anarchy has spread with the regions turning rogue.
There are further rumours that even Abington's main city Suville could leave the realm.

Falasan Flag mini.png General Steps Down

August 31th 2007


Falasan's General Sir Yavuz, Baron of Nazgorn, Marshal of the army of Barad Falas has stepped down from his General position. He gave the following reason:
"I have not the time as before to perform my duties, and that is effecting the overall performance of the army."
King Gucky has since appointed Sir Crashem, Marquis of Belegmon as High Marshal/General of the realm.

Falasan Flag mini.png The Aquitaine Succession

August 21th 2007


The Newly Created realm Aquitaine by Spiritmonger's succession of the duchy Riverholm has allready lost two regions to there former master Abington. ( Lanston & Wynford ). The succession has also prompted the Ash Sea Islands to declare war on Aquitaine.

Falasan Flag mini.png On enemy soil

August 16th 2007


This morning the Falasan forces, made up of the regular army and the elite Black Army, quickly crossed from Menedor into Amdor and with relative ease smashed the Estonite defenders. With no apparent retaliation in scouts sight, this could be the long awaited breakthrough Falasan has been waiting for. With passage to Dondor, Barad Lacirith and Meneriel it will be difficult for Eston to defend their interior.
